UC Riverside vs. Agape College of Business and Science
Both University of California-Riverside and Agape College of Business and Science are 4 years schools located in California. The following statements compare University of California-Riverside and Agape College of Business and Science with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
- UC Riverside's tuition ($44,947) is more expensive than Agape College of Business and Science ($8,132).

- Agape College of Business and Science's students to faculty ratio (7 to 1) is lower than UC Riverside (24 to 1).
- UC Riverside (26,809 students) is larger than Agape College of Business and Science (37 students) with more enrolled students.
- UC Riverside ($20,324) has higher amount of financial aid than Agape College of Business and Science ($3,632).
- Agape College of Business and Science's graduation rate (100%) is higher than UC Riverside (76%).
